UPF file format updated completely, UPFv2 introduced:
* ld1.x can still produce old format, with the switch upf_v1_format=.true. in inputp
  this is disabled by default, but we can discuss if it should be the opposite.
* pw.x cp.x and all utilities should notice no difference
* some utilities in upftools still need to be updated, anyway conversion UPFv1 to UPFv2
  is very easy, so this should be no big issue
* starting from now to produce an UPF file you need to fill the pseudo_upf derivedd type
  and feed it to write_upf woutine in upf_module (Modules/upf.f90)
* extensive use of iotk

I have tried to make the new format as self contained as possible, e.g. there should be
minimal need for post-processing after the data is read, no more reconstruction of known
quantities, and no more odd syntax to save negligible quantity of space. Also the human
readable section is a bit richer, all the rest is more machine readable.

I hope this will not cause any throuble, and tried really hard to, all examples and all
tests works as fine as before and gives (what really looks like) the same results.

sbraccia ea0935fb5f Fixed a bug in the definition of the diagonalization thresholds for empty
states. This bug (introduced at the end of May 2005) was responsible for
somehow wrong results in the case of calculations with many k-points.
Cleanup of diagonalization thresholds: wg_set variable removed and btype array
is now set in sum_band.
Added a logical input variable (diago_full_acc) to decide if the empty states
(defined as states with occupation < 1%) have to be converged at full accuracy
or not. Defaul is .FALSE. (I am not sure this is the best choice, comments
appreciated).

cavazzon 7699b67b62 Small fix for SGI compiler and FORMAT descriptor within a write statement:
write(6, ' ( " .... ", &
   " .... " ) ' )
changed to
 write(6, ' ( " .... ", &
  &  " .... " ) ' )

The sgi compiler is right, the descriptor is a string '( ... )'
and a continuation is possible only if "&" is added at the beginning
of the line
